Currently, we are looking for Lube & Tire Technicians to join our team.

The primary responsibilities of our Lube/Tire Technicians include passenger tire service, basic vehicle maintenance and repair, and vehicle inspections.

For tires (functions performed per TIA guidelines):

  • Remove, install, rotate, balance, and perform flat repairs
  • Reset TPMS when needed
  • Inspect tread depth, air pressure, and carcass for defects, for every tire that comes through, and recommend corrective action

For vehicles:

  • Inspect vehicles using our DVI device (digital visual inspection) and report potential repairs to supervisor.
  • Perform basic maintenance and repair, including oil changes, chassis lubrication, filter and fluid inspection and replacement, and other light mechanical items and repairs
  • Raise and lower vehicles safely, with hydraulic or floor jacks
  • Safely operate all shop machinery, including but not limited to: rim clamp machine, balancer, floor jacks or lifts, air powered tools, torque wrench and/or torque sticks, and parts washer
  • Read work orders thoroughly and perform all listed tasks
  • Perform general housekeeping duties.
  • Help to load/unload delivery trucks.
  • Each morning, set up tire racks, signs and other displays; store them neatly at the end of the day.
  • Perform other duties, from time to time, as assigned by the supervisor.
